Facebook Retail Marketing?

Well the tie between us and our mobile is so strong, and a big part of that is our connection to social media apps like Facebook, and Facebook knows that well it analysis your data, and a big part of its retail marketing strategy is tracking people’s behavior and that where he creates the Facebook pixel.

The Facebook pixel is code that you place on your website. It collects data that helps you track conversions from Facebook ads, optimize ads, build targeted audiences for future ads, and remarket to people who have already taken some action on your website.

It works by placing and triggering cookies to track users as they interact with your website and your Facebook ads.

Marketing with QR codes is a great way to bridge your online and offline marketing efforts.

Using QR codes with your campaigns is a great way to introduce users to your digital marketing funnel. It is easy and convenient for users to scan them and get an offer or find out more about the product. You in return can get a measure of your marketing success if you use the right tools.

But how can QR codes help me measure marketing success you ask?

Well with using the modern marketing automation and analytics tools of course. Since a QR code links to a digital resource, this can be used to gather attribution and analytic information. When you have a person scan your campaign QR code, for example, it is possible to learn valuable information like their location, time of scanning, the platform they are using, etc. You can also use this to geofence your campaigns to specific areas.

Another simple trick to try would be using different QR codes for variations of the same campaign to test the effectiveness of the variables you change.

By turning QR codes into Dynamic and Trackable QR codes, Smart Deep Links technology makes it easy for users to get onboard within the apps. These context-sensitive links provide the following benefits:

  • They will take the user to their destination regardless of the platform they are using.
  • Let’s say they don’t have your app and are using an iPhone, the link will take them to download the app from App Store.
  • If they are using an Android device instead, the same link will take them to Play Store page of the app.
